    Is there a way to put the <?php echo nggv_imageVoteForm($image->pid); ?> in the nextgen-gallery/view/imagebrowser.php file safely?

    Currently it seems to have the potential to work however it loads my vote image as an enlarged image and also includes an enlarged spinning load image as well.

    This would allow for people to direct others directly to their image for voting.

    Hi soundmutant

    It should work if you put the tag AFTER the .ngg-imagebrowser div is CLOSED.
    But, some themes will still see the images the voting plugin is using, assume they are part of the gallery, and mess with their sizes. If your theme is doing that after moving the voting form outside of the .ngg-imagebrowser div, then send me the link to your site, and I will see if I can show you some CSS your can add to fix it for your specific site.
